Output 25409316c716142a48593249a633d32cb2662f42979dc0704ba5cd892b9ed773:13

value
307795350
script pubkey
OP_0 OP_PUSHBYTES_20 50bf26c44b2cb19ef4706fa22e500f057bcd3188
address
ltc1q2zljd3zt9jceaarsd73zu5q0q4au6vvgqv8axy
transaction
25409316c716142a48593249a633d32cb2662f42979dc0704ba5cd892b9ed773
spent
true